Patients in all countries however Norway and Sweden revealed higher confidence. The large uninsured (and underinsured) population is a well-recognized problem in the United States. All other peer nations provide their populaces global or near-universal medical insurance protection. Just 3 OECD countriesChile, Mexico, and Turkeyprovide much less insurance coverage than the United States (OECD, 2011b).


One out of 3 united state patients with a chronic health problem or a current need for intense care records investing greater than $1,000 annually in out-of-pocket expenses (Schoen et al., 2011) (see Table 4-1). Higher medical expenses can contribute to the U.S. health downside if they trigger patients to pass up required treatment (Wendt et al., 2011).


In 2009, annual assessments in the USA were 3.9 per head, a lower rate than in all peer nations but Sweden and less than the OECD average of 6.5 per capita (OECD, 2011b). Nonetheless, medical professional assessment prices are an imperfect action of gain access to due to the fact that they are dumbfounded by lots of factors, such as plans that require an in-person doctor go to for a reference or to re-fill a prescription.

Macinko et al. (2003 ) used 10 criteria to place the primary treatment systems of 18 high-income countries (consisting of copyright, Australia, Japan, and 14 European countries). The United States had the weakest health care score of all the nations in 1975 and 1985 and the 3rd weakest in 1995 (Macinko et al., 2003).

Connection of treatment from a routine company, which is crucial to effective monitoring of chronic problems (Liss et al., 2011), might be extra tenuous in the USA than in similar countries. Only a little over half (57 percent) of united state respondents to the 2011 Republic Fund study reported being with the same medical professional for a minimum of 5 years, a reduced rate than all contrast countries other than Sweden (Schoen et al., 2011.


clients were more probable than individuals in other countries except copyright to report visiting an emergency situation department for a problem that might have been treated by their regular medical professional had actually one been readily available (Schoen et al., 2009b). The United States has less medical facility beds per capita than a lot of other countries, but this action may be dumbfounded by raising initiatives to supply treatment in less expensive outpatient settings.


In a comparison of eight nations, Wunsch and colleagues (2008 ) reported that the USA had the third greatest concentration of important treatment beds (beds in intensive care devices per 100,000 populace). The accessibility of long-lasting care beds for U.S. grownups ages 65 and older is lower than for those in 10 of the 16 peer countries.

Inadequate insurance, minimal accessibility to clinicians and facilities, and various other shipment system deficiencies can affect just how quickly individuals receive the treatment they require. Feedbacks to the Republic Fund studies suggest that united state clients with complex treatment needs are extra likely than those in several various other countries to encounter delays in seeing a doctor or registered nurse within 12 days, particularly after regular office hours, making it essential to count on an emergency department (Schoen et al., 2011).


There is proof of variance in wellness defense and other public wellness services across communities and populace teams in the United States (Culyer and Lomas, 2006), there is little straight evidence to determine whether and exactly how this differs across high-income countries. Contrasting the quality of public health and wellness solutions in the USA to that of various other nations is difficult because of the absence of equivalent global information on the shipment of core public wellness functions.

U.S. patients evaluated by the Republic Fund were more most likely to report specific medical errors and delays in getting uncommon test results than were individuals in many various other countries (Schoen et al., 2011).

For several years, top quality improvement programs and health services study have actually identified that the fragmented nature of the U.S. healthcare system, miscommunication, and inappropriate details systems raise gaps in treatment; oversights and mistakes; and unneeded rep of testing, treatment, and associated risks due to the fact that records of previous solutions are not available (Fineberg, 2012; Institute of Medicine, 2000, 2010).
